Improved HDR Capabilities in Nintendo Switch 2 Update – Adjust Brightness and White Levels for Optimized Image Quality
Since its launch several months ago, the Nintendo Switch 2 has established itself within the gaming community, marked by consistent game releases, successes, and regular user experience improvements. Updates have enhanced gameplay for titles like Resident Evil 4 and Miitopia. Nintendo is also expanding backwards compatibility. An October update improved Warframe, and popular first-party games such as Breath of the Wild and Tears of the Kingdom now feature better image quality and smoother gameplay. Version 21.1.0, released in December 2025, delivers further enhancements, including improvements to the console’s HDR capabilities, as highlighted by the HDTestTV YouTube channel. While Nintendo has not emphasized the specifics, this update provides tangible benefits for users. Beyond general performance improvements, it addresses previous issues with HDR not functioning correctly on various screen models. Some users still report washed-out HDR even after the update, while others speculate that the issue lies with their TV setup. According to HDTestTV, two new options now allow Nintendo Switch 2 owners to optimize HDR: During brightness adjustment, pressing the Y button displays the specific maximum brightness value. Adjusting HDR white levels now defaults to a reduced console brightness setting for improved out-of-the-box image quality.
Enhancing HDR with HGig and Brightness Adjustments on Nintendo Switch 2 for Optimal Visual Experience
For optimal results, HDTestTV recommends enabling the HGig option (if available), then, on the second screen, moving the slider five clicks to the left after pressing Y, followed by further brightness adjustments as needed. These HDR adjustments provide Nintendo Switch 2 users with more precise control over their visual experience, a welcome improvement as they enjoy a growing library of games.
